Carmo Moves into Chip Lead

Level 13 : 250/500, 60 ante

Yuan Yuan "SunnySummer" Li opened from the cutoff for 1,250 and Guilherme "romeuu" Carmo three-bet to 5,110 from the small blind. Action folded around and Limade the call.

The flop came {q-Hearts}{3-Diamonds}{5-Spades} and Carmo fired 3,696 to a quick call. The turn was {3-Clubs} and Carmo slowed down with a check but called the bet of 9,292 from Li. The river was a {10-Spades} and Carmo checked once more.

Li jammed for 17,073 and after using some time bank Carmo made the call with {a-Diamonds}{k-Clubs} to beat the bluff of {k-Diamonds}{j-Diamonds} from Li and knock them out of the tournament.

Negreanu Goes for a Double

Level 14 : 300/600, 75 ante

Daniel Negreanu opened from under the gun with a raise for 1,320. "duh_ekstaza" called from the next seat over and action folded to "staxinplay" for the call from the small blind and "DragonFly667" for the call from the big blind.

The flop came {q-Diamonds}{8-Hearts}{5-Diamonds} and the blinds checked. Negreanu led out for 2,352 and "duh_ekstaza" folded. "staxinplay" check-raised to 12,936 and "DragonFly667" got out of the way. Negreanu called for his last 6,599.

Daniel Negreanu: {k-Spades}{q-Spades}
"staxinplay": {q-Clubs}{10-Spades}

The turn came {9-Spades}, giving "staxinplay" outs to a straight, but the {8-Diamonds} was no help and Negreanu grabbed a crucial double up to stay alive.

Negreanu Races for Another Double

Level 15 : 350/700, 85 ante

"MuchBrokenWow" opened from under the gun with a raise to 1,540. Action folded around to Daniel Negreanu in the big blind for a three-bet to 5,637. After using some time bank, "MuchBrokenNow" jammed and Negreanu made the call for his last 14,725.

Daniel Negreanu: {a-Diamonds}{k-Spades}
"MuchBrokenWow": {q-Hearts}{q-Clubs}

The flop ran out {7-Clubs}{8-Diamonds}{3-Diamonds} with no help for Negreanu, but the turn {k-Hearts} gave him the lead and the river {7-Spades} sealed the deal on another important double up.
